When it comes to jewelry wire production, understanding the different types of machines is crucial. Options vary widely in function and design. Some machines focus on drawing, while others are specialized in winding. Each type caters to specific wire needs. For example, a drawing machine reduces the diameter of metal wires, ensuring precision.
Quality is essential in jewelry production. Look for machines that offer consistent results. A reliable machine will minimize waste and enhance productivity. Additionally, features like user-friendliness matter. An overly complicated machine can lead to frustration. It may also decrease efficiency.
Maintenance is another important consideration. Regular upkeep can prolong a machine's lifespan. However, many users overlook this aspect, which can lead to costly repairs. Investing in a user-friendly guide for maintenance can provide clarity. Understanding these various factors can significantly impact your production process.

When selecting a jewelry wire production machine, certain key features can significantly enhance your manufacturing process. Consider the wire diameter range it can handle. A versatile machine should accommodate various gauges, ensuring it meets different design requirements. The ability to adjust tension settings is also crucial. Proper tension affects the wire’s malleability and durability. Look for machines that offer precise adjustments for optimal performance.
Another important aspect is the machine's ease of use. An intuitive interface allows operators to transition between tasks quickly. Safety features should never be overlooked, either. Emergency stop functions and protective barriers enhance user safety. Additionally, check the machine's maintenance requirements. A machine that requires frequent servicing can disrupt your workflow.
Streamlined maintenance protocols keep production running smoothly.
Energy efficiency is often an overlooked feature but can save costs over time. Eco-friendly machines contribute positively to a company’s sustainability goals.
However, weigh initial costs against long-term benefits to avoid hasty decisions. Gathering user reviews often provides insight into the reliability of a machine.
A machine may seem perfect on paper but can fall short in real-world application.
Striking a balance between features and usability can lead to better efficiency in production.
When choosing a jewelry wire production machine, assessing quality and durability is crucial. Durable machines can significantly impact production rates and output quality. According to a recent industry report, machines that align with ISO standards show a 30% increase in lifespan compared to non-compliant ones. This data suggests that investing in quality equipment can yield long-term savings.
Pay attention to the materials used in the machine's construction. Machines built with high-grade steel resist wear and tear. A weak frame may lead to misalignment, resulting in inconsistent wire thickness. Inconsistent production can frustrate operators and lead to wasted materials, impacting profitability.
Assessing user reviews and expert recommendations can also provide insight into a machine's reliability. However, not all reviews are trustworthy. Some may prioritize brand popularity over actual performance. It’s important to cross-examine opinions from various sources. Often, the best choice comes from understanding the machine’s specifications and how they align with your production needs. It’s essential to reflect on your unique requirements to avoid common pitfalls.
